Dear Anyone,

I have been married to my husband since 1994. When I married him I knew he was a disabled veteran with many health problems. In the beginning of our marriage, he would hit me a lot. During this time I gave birth to my 2 children(had 1 child from first marriage- 3 total) The beating stopped in 1997. In 2004, I had a ruptured brain aneurysms. Ever since then he has treated me and talked about me very bad to my children. I have slept on the couch for the last 9 months. I want out, but the kids love him and have been brainwashed by him. They have started to say the same things to me as he does. Everyday he makes me look like dirt or worse to my children. He also makes all the money.

A broke, tired, hurt, mother of 3
